Dr. Mildred Stahlman, the pioneering creator of the Vanderbilt newborn intensive care unit, has tragically passed away. The news of her death has sent shockwaves through the medical community, as colleagues and friends mourn the loss of a true visionary in the field of neonatology.

Dr. Stahlman dedicated her life to the care and treatment of premature and critically ill infants. Her groundbreaking work at Vanderbilt University Medical Center revolutionized the way premature babies were cared for, saving countless lives in the process. Her passion and dedication to her work were evident to all who knew her, and her legacy will continue to inspire future generations of healthcare professionals.

The cause of Dr. Stahlman’s death has not been confirmed at this time, as details surrounding her passing remain unclear.
